Lost or Stolen Documents. Losing your passport or visa can be a stressful experience, but the immigration authorities can provide assistance. The first step is to report the loss or theft to the local police and obtain a police report. Next, contact the GDRFA to report the missing documents and begin the process of getting replacements. Having access to their contact details makes the reporting and replacement procedure more smooth. This is very important. Always keep copies of your important documents in a secure place, separate from the originals.
